QB John Mateer upgraded to probable for game against Texas

By CLIFF BRUNT AP Sports Writer (AP) — Oklahoma quarterback John Mateer's status has been upgraded to probable for the Sooners' game on Saturday against Texas. Mateer injured his right hand during a 24-17 win over Auburn on Sept. 20. The change from questionable was listed Thursday on the Southeastern Conference availability report. John Mateer sets record in debut, leading No. 18 Sooners to 35-3 win over Illinois State

By CLIFF BRUNT AP Sports Writer NORMAN, Okla. (AP) — John Mateer passed for 392 yards and three touchdowns in a record-setting first game at Oklahoma, and the 18th-ranked Sooners beat Illinois State 35-3 on Saturday night.
